BACKGROUND: Dispersal is a fundamental process to animal population dynamics and gene flow. In white-tailed deer (WTD; Odocoileus virginianus), dispersal also presents an increasingly relevant risk for the spread of infectious diseases. Across their wide range, WTD dispersal is believed to be driven by a suite of landscape and host behavioral factors, but these can vary by region, season, and sex. Our objectives were to (1) identify dispersal events in Wisconsin WTD and determine drivers of dispersal rates and distances, and (2) determine how landscape features (e.g., rivers, roads) structure deer dispersal paths. METHODS: We developed an algorithmic approach to detect dispersal events from GPS collar data for 590 juvenile, yearling, and adult WTD. We used statistical models to identify host and landscape drivers of dispersal rates and distances, including the role of agricultural land use, the traversability of the landscape, and potential interactions between deer. We then performed a step selection analysis to determine how landscape features such as agricultural land use, elevation, rivers, and roads affected deer dispersal paths. RESULTS: Dispersal predominantly occurred in juvenile males, of which 64.2% dispersed, with dispersal events uncommon in other sex and age classes. Juvenile male dispersal probability was positively associated with the proportion of the natal range that was classified as agricultural land use, but only during the spring. Dispersal distances were typically short (median 5.77 km, range: 1.3-68.3 km), especially in the fall. Further, dispersal distances were positively associated with agricultural land use in potential dispersal paths but negatively associated with the number of proximate deer in the natal range. Lastly, we found that, during dispersal, juvenile males typically avoided agricultural land use but selected for areas near rivers and streams. CONCLUSION: Land use-particularly agricultural-was a key driver of dispersal rates, distances, and paths in Wisconsin WTD. In addition, our results support the importance of deer social environments in shaping dispersal behavior. Our findings reinforce knowledge of dispersal ecology in WTD and how landscape factors-including major rivers, roads, and land-use patterns-structure host gene flow and potential pathogen transmission.

PURPOSE: To compare perception of accelerated and traditional medical students, with respect to satisfaction with education quality, and the learning environment, residency readiness, burnout, debt, and career plans. METHOD: Customized 2017 and 2018 Medical School Graduation Questionnaires (GQs) were analyzed using independent samples t tests for means and chi-square tests for percentages, comparing responses of accelerated MD program graduates (accelerated pathway [AP] students) from 9 schools with those of non-AP graduates from the same 9 schools and non-AP graduates from all surveyed schools. RESULTS: GQ completion rates for the 90 AP students, 2,573 non-AP students from AP schools, and 38,116 non-AP students from all schools in 2017 and 2018 were 74.4%, 82.3%, and 83.3%, respectively. AP students were as satisfied with the quality of their education and felt as prepared for residency as non-AP students. AP students reported a more positive learning climate than non-AP students from AP schools and from all schools as measured by the student-faculty interaction (15.9 vs 14.4 and 14.3, respectively; P < .001 for both pairwise comparisons) and emotional climate (10.7 vs 9.6 and 9.6, respectively; P = .004 and .003, respectively) scales. AP students had less debt than non-AP students (P < .001), and more planned to care for underserved populations and practice family medicine than non-AP students from AP schools (55.7% vs 33.9% and 37.7% vs 9.4%; P = .002 and < .001, respectively). Family expectations were a more common influence on career plans for AP students than for non-AP students from AP schools and from all schools (26.2% vs 11.3% and 11.7%, respectively; P < .001 for both pairwise comparisons). CONCLUSIONS: These findings support accelerated programs as a potentially important intervention to address workforce shortages and rising student debt without negative impacts on student perception of burnout, education quality, or residency preparedness.

White-tailed deer (WTD; Odocoileus virginianus) are a critical species for ecosystem function and wildlife management. As such, studies of cause-specific mortality among WTD have long been used to understand population dynamics. However, detailed pathological information is rarely documented for free-ranging WTD, especially in regions with a high prevalence of chronic wasting disease (CWD). This leaves a significant gap in understanding how CWD is associated with disease processes or comorbidities that may subsequently alter broader population dynamics. We investigated unknown mortalities among collared WTD in southwestern Wisconsin, USA, an area of high CWD prevalence. We tested for associations between CWD and other disease processes and used a network approach to test for co-occurring disease processes. Predation and infectious disease were leading suspected causes of death, with high prevalence of CWD (42.4%; of 245 evaluated) and pneumonia (51.2%; of 168 evaluated) in our sample. CWD prevalence increased with age, before decreasing among older individuals, with more older females than males in our sample. Females were more likely to be CWD positive, and although this was not statistically significant when accounting for age, females were significantly more likely to die with end-stage CWD than males and may consequently be an underrecognized source of CWD transmission. Presence of CWD was associated with emaciation, atrophy of marrow fat and hematopoietic cells, and ectoparasitism (lice and ticks). Occurrences of severe infectious disease processes clustered together (e.g., pneumonia, CWD), as compared to noninfectious or low-severity processes (e.g., sarcocystosis), although pneumonia cases were not fully explained by CWD status. With the prevalence of CWD increasing across North America, our results highlight the critical importance of understanding the potential role of CWD in favoring or maintaining disease processes of importance for deer population health and dynamics.

INTRODUCTION: Regional or state studies in the USA have documented shortages of rural physicians and other healthcare professionals that can impact on access to health services. The purpose of this study was to determine whether rural hospital chief executive officers (CEOs) in the USA report shortages of health professions and to obtain perceptions about factors influencing recruiting and retention. METHODS: A nationwide US survey was conducted of 1031 rural hospital CEOs identified by regional/state Area Health Education Centers. A three-page survey was sent containing questions about whether or not physician shortages were present in the CEO's community and asking about physician needs by specialty. The CEOs were also asked to assess whether other health professionals were needed in their town or within a 48 km (30 mile) radius. Analyses from 335 respondents (34.4%) representative of rural hospital CEOs in the USA are presented. RESULTS: Primary care shortages based on survey responses were very similar to the pattern for all rural areas in the USA (49% vs 52%, respectively). The location of respondents according to ZIP code rurality status was similar to all rural areas in the USA (moderately rural, 29.3% vs 27.6%, respectively), and 69.1% were located in highly rural ZIP codes (vs 72.4% of highly rural ZIP codes for all USA). Physician shortages were reported by 75.4% of the rural CEOs, and 70.3% indicated shortages of two or more primary care specialties. The most frequently reported shortage was family medicine (FM, 58.3%) followed by general internal medicine (IM, 53.1%). Other reported shortages were: psychiatry (46.6%); general surgery (39.9%); neurology (36.4%); pediatrics (PEDS, 36.2%); cardiology (35%); and obstetrics-gynecology (34.4%). The three most commonly needed allied health professions were registered nurses (73.5%), physical therapists (61.2%) and pharmacists (51%). The percentage of CEOs reporting shortages of two or more primary care specialties (FM, IM or PEDS) was 70.3% nationally, with no statistically significant regional variation (p = .394), while higher for the New England through Virginia region (83.9%) than for all other regions. The CEOs reported the highest specialty care shortages for psychiatry (46.6%) followed by general surgery (39.9%), neurology (36.4%), cardiology (35.0%) and obstetrics-gynecology (34.4%). Major specialty shortages varied among regions and only for neurology and cardiology were regional differences statistically significant (p < .05). Marked variation between need for healthcare professionals were reported ranging from approximately 73% for registered nurses (RNs) to 16% for health educators. Reporting of need for RNs in rural areas was nearly 74% nationally and 35% reported a need for nurse practitioners. Differences for both RNs and nurse practitioners were not statistically significant among regions. Nationally, approximately 30% of CEOs reported a shortage of licensed practical nurses, which differed significantly among regions (p = .006). There was variation in physical therapist shortages among regions (p = .001), with 61.2% of CEOs reporting shortages nationally. Regional variation pattern was observed for pharmacists (p = .004) with approximately 50% of rural CEOs reporting a need for pharmacists nationally. The association between CEOs' reported shortages of two or more primary care doctors and their indication of the need for other health professionals was statistically significant for nurse practitioners, physician assistants, pharmacists, and dentists. The recruitment and retention attributes deemed to be of greatest importance were: (1) healthcare is a major part of the local economy; (2) community is a good place for family; (3) doctors are well-respected and supported; and (4) people in the community are friendly and supportive of each other. These were remarkably similar across 6 US geographic regions. CONCLUSIONS: Similarities in shortages and attributes influencing recruitment across regions suggest that major policy and program interventions are needed to develop a rural health professions workforce that will enable the benefits of recent US health reform insurance coverage to be realized. Substantial and targeted programs to increase rural healthcare professionals are needed.

OBJECTIVE: Extracellular vesicles derived from oral cancer cells, which include Exosomes and Oncosomes, are membranous vesicles secreted into the surrounding extracellular environment. These extracellular vesicles can regulate and modulate oral squamous cell carcinoma (OSCC) progression through the horizontal transfer of bioactive molecules including proteins, lipids and microRNA (miRNA). The primary objective of this study was to examine the potential to isolate and evaluate extracellular vesicles (including exosomes) from various oral cancer cell lines and to explore potential differences in miRNA content. METHODS: The OSCC cell lines SCC9, SCC25 and CAL27 were cultured in DMEM containing 10% exosome-free fetal bovine serum. Cell-culture conditioned media was collected for exosome and extracellular vesicle isolation after 72 hours. Isolation was completed using the Total Exosome Isolation reagent (Invitrogen) and extracellular vesicle RNA was purified using the Total Exosome RNA isolation kit (Invitrogen). Extracellular vesicle miRNA content was evaluated using primers specific for miR-16, -21, -133a and -155. RESULTS: Extracellular vesicles were successfully isolated from all three OSCC cell lines and total extracellular vesicle RNA was isolated. Molecular screening using primers specific for several miRNA revealed differential baseline expression among the different cell lines. The addition of melatonin significantly reduced the expression of miR-155 in all of the OSCC extracellular vesicles. However, miR-21 was significantly increased in each of the three OSCC isolates. No significant changes in miR-133a expression were observed under melatonin administration. CONCLUSIONS: Although many studies have documented changes in gene expression among various cancers under melatonin administration, few studies have evaluated these effects on microRNAs. These results may be among the first to evaluate the effects of melatonin on microRNA expression in oral cancers, which suggests the differential modulation of specific microRNAs, such as miR-21, miR-133a and miR-155, may be of significant importance when evaluating the mechanisms and pathways involved in melatonin-associated anti-tumor effects.

In the last decade, there has been renewed interest in three-year MD pathway programs. In 2015, with support from the Josiah Macy Jr., Foundation, eight North American medical schools with three-year accelerated medical pathway programs formed the Consortium of Accelerated Medical Pathway Programs (CAMPP). The schools are two campuses of the Medical College of Wisconsin; McMaster University Michael G. DeGroote School of Medicine; Mercer University School of Medicine; New York University School of Medicine; Penn State College of Medicine; Texas Tech University Health Sciences Center School of Medicine; University of California, Davis School of Medicine; and University of Louisville School of Medicine. These programs vary in size and medical specialty focus but all include the reduction of student debt from savings in tuition costs. Each school's mission to create a three-year pathway program differs; common themes include the ability to train physicians to practice in underserved areas or to allow students for whom the choice of specialty is known to progress more quickly. Compared with McMaster, these programs are small, but most capitalize on training and assessing competency across the undergraduate medical education-graduate medical education continuum and include conditional acceptance into an affiliated residency program. This article includes an overview of each CAMPP school with attention to admissions, curriculum, financial support, and regulatory challenges associated with the design of an accelerated pathway program. These programs are relatively new, with a small number of graduates; this article outlines opportunities and challenges for schools considering the development of accelerated programs.

PURPOSE: To report on the retention and practice outcomes of the University of Illinois College of Medicine at Rockford Rural Medical Education (RMED) Program and to examine distance from influential locations in relation to graduates' current practice location. METHOD: The RMED Program recruits candidates from rural backgrounds, provides a supplemental curriculum addressing rural topics and experiences, and tracks graduates' practice location and specialty choice outcomes. Practice location and specialty were compared for 160 RMED graduates and 2,663 non-RMED graduates, from 1997 to 2007. Rural status was based on rural-urban commuting codes. Comparisons were made using cross-tabulation with calculation of chi-square or odds ratios to assess differences. RESULTS: RMED graduates were 14.4 times more likely than non-RMED graduates to choose family medicine; 6.7 times more likely to choose a primary care practice specialty; 17.2 times more likely to be currently practicing in a rural location; and 12.8 times more likely to be currently practicing in a primary care shortage zip code. Analysis of current RMED graduates' practice locations indicates that 41.9% were within 90 miles of their fourth-year preceptorship community. Among RMED graduates practicing in Illinois, 62.1% and 73.3% were located within 60 and 90 miles, respectively, of their hometown. CONCLUSIONS: Recruitment of students combined with a rural-focused curriculum yielded positive outcomes related to primary care practice and decisions regarding practice location. RMED graduates were considerably more likely than non-RMED graduates to choose family medicine, choose a primary care specialty, and be currently practicing in a rural location.

PURPOSE: Comprehensive medical school rural programs (RPs) have made demonstrable contributions to the rural physician workforce, but their relative impact is uncertain. This study compares rural primary care practice outcomes for RP graduates within relevant states with those of international medical graduates (IMGs), also seen as ameliorating rural physician shortages. METHOD: Using data from the 2010 American Medical Association Physician Masterfile, the authors identified all 1,757 graduates from three RPs (Jefferson Medical College's Physician Shortage Area Program; University of Minnesota Medical School Duluth; University of Illinois College of Medicine at Rockford's Rural Medical Education Program) practicing in their respective states, and all 6,474 IMGs practicing in the same states and graduating the same years. The relative likelihoods of RP graduates versus IMGs practicing rural family medicine and rural primary care were compared. RESULTS: RP graduates were 10 times more likely to practice rural family medicine than IMGs (relative risk [RR] = 10.0, confidence interval [CI] 8.7-11.6, P < .001) and almost 4 times as likely to practice any rural primary care specialty (RR 3.8, CI 3.5-4.2, P < .001). Overall, RPs produced more rural family physicians than the IMG cohort (376 versus 254). CONCLUSIONS: Despite their relatively small size, RPs had a significant impact on rural family physician and primary care supply compared with the much larger cohort of IMGs. Wider adoption of the RP model would substantially increase access to care in rural areas compared with increasing reliance on IMGs or unfocused expansion of traditional medical schools.

This article presents the characteristics and results of the Rural Medical Education (RMED) Program which addresses medical workforce needs focused on reducing rural health disparities. The program is comprehensive in implementing a system of recruitment of candidates from rural backgrounds, offering a rural-focused curriculum, and instituting evaluative components to track outcomes. Distinctive program features include a Recruitment and Retention Committee of rural community members; special rural-focused topics and events during the first three years of undergraduate medical education; and a required fourth-year, 16-week rural preceptorship through which students work with primary care physicians and conduct community-oriented primary care projects. Since 1993, 216 students have matriculated. More than three quarters of candidates interviewed received offers into the program (overall acceptance rate of 75%). Comparisons between RMED and all other students on composite MCAT scores and United States Medical Licensing Examination (USMLE) Part 1 scores show a slightly lower MCAT average for RMED students, but USMLE scores are equal to those of non-RMED students. To date, 159 students have graduated, with 76% entering primary care residencies; 103 are currently in practice, with 64.4% in primary care practice in small towns and/or rural communities. RMED Program outcomes compare favorably with those of other rural medical education programs. RMED can serve as a model at many levels, including recruitment, collaboration, curriculum, and retention. Future challenges for program development and disparity reduction include recruiting students from the growing number of rural minority populations, expanding the number of program slots, and integrating the program with other health professions to address the needs of rural populations.
